Family/military connectionsBrothers: 566 Corporal Archie Gordon LEWIS, 16th Bn, died of wounds, 1 September 1916; 115 Pte Charles Stephen LEWIS, 28th Bn, died of wounds, 14 August 1916;120 Pte John Percival LEWIS, 10th Light Horse Regiment, killed in action, 7 August 1915.
Other details

War service: Western Front

Wounded in action, 12 October 1917; remained at duty.

Applied for discharge, August 1918: 'My three brothers have all been killed in action during the present war, and I am the only remaining son of our family. I am 38 years of age and have done eighteen months continuous service with this Battalion. Both my parents are well on in years and I am their sole support. If I get killed they will be left destitute and I consider it my duty to get back and support them abd tend them in their last years. I consider that my family has done its duty toward the Empire and I trust that this application will meet with success.' Application approved, 29 August 1918.

Commenced return to Australia on board HT 'Runic', 23 September 1918; discharged (family reasons: 3 brothers killed), Perth, 2 December 1918.
